Two referees needed
You must give details of two people who can provide us with a reference.
One of them should be your current or last employer. You can state on
the form whether we may contact your referees before the interview
stage of the selection process.
When we ask for references, we will send your referees a copy of the job
outline and person specification, and will ask specific questions about
your suitability for the post. Offers of appointment depend on our
receiving satisfactory references.
Equality Monitoring
By completing the equality monitoring form, you help us to check that
our recruitment processes are fair and effective. The equality monitoring
form is separated from the application form when it arrives at the
Learning Disabilities Federation. The information is kept confidential and
is not passed to the shortlisting panel.

We are an equal opportunity employer. The aim of our policy is to ensure that no job applicant or employee receives less
favourable treatment on the grounds of race, colour, ethnic or national origin, religious belief, sex, marital status, sexual orientation,
gender reassignment, age or disability, or is disadvantaged by conditions or requirements which cannot be shown to be justifiable.
Our selection criteria and procedures are frequently reviewed to ensure that individuals are selected, promoted and treated on the
basis of their relevant merits and abilities.
All employees are given equal opportunity and are encouraged to progress within the organisation.
